What is Engine Oil Filter Cross Reference?​

Engine oil filter cross reference is the practice of finding equivalent oil filters that can be used in place of the original equipment manufacturer (OEM) filter. When you own a vehicle, the manufacturer typically specifies a particular oil filter model, such as a Fram PH8A or a Mobil M1-104. However, many other companies produce filters that are designed to fit the same application and provide similar or even superior performance. Cross referencing involves comparing specifications like thread size, gasket design, pressure relief settings, and dimensions to find matches. This is particularly useful when the OEM filter is unavailable, overpriced, or when you prefer a different brand based on quality or cost. For example, if your car manual recommends a specific AC Delco filter, you can use a cross reference chart to find that a Wix or K&N filter might be a direct replacement. The key is to ensure that the alternative filter meets the required standards for your engine to avoid damage.

Steps to Perform an Accurate Oil Filter Cross Reference

Performing an oil filter cross reference correctly requires attention to detail to ensure compatibility. Start by identifying the current oil filter model number. This is usually printed on the filter itself or listed in your vehicle’s owner manual. For example, if you have a Ford with a Motorcraft FL-910 filter, write down that number. Next, use a reliable cross reference tool. Many websites and mobile apps offer free databases where you input the model number, and they generate a list of equivalents. Brands like Wix, Fram, and Purolator have their own cross reference charts on their official sites. When you get the list, compare key specifications. Check the thread size (e.g., 3/4-16 UNF), gasket outer diameter, and anti-drain back valve type. Also, look at the bypass valve pressure rating, which should match to prevent oil starvation. It is wise to double-check with multiple sources to avoid errors. For instance, if a cross reference tool suggests a certain filter, confirm it on the manufacturer’s website or consult a professional mechanic. Finally, always inspect the physical filter before installation to ensure it looks identical in size and features.

Common Oil Filter Brands and Their Cross Reference Compatibility

Several major brands dominate the oil filter market, and understanding their cross reference options can simplify your search. ​Fram​ is one of the most popular brands, with models like the PH8A being interchangeable with many others. For example, a Fram PH8A cross references to a Bosch 3330, a Purolator L30001, and a Mobil M1-108. Similarly, ​Wix​ filters are known for quality and have extensive cross reference databases; a Wix 51515 might match an AC Delco PF61 or a NAPA 1515. ​K&N​ offers high-performance filters that often cross reference to standard options, such as a K&N HP-1004 equivalent to a Motorcraft FL-820. Other brands like ​Bosch, ​Purolator, and ​Mobil 1​ also provide easy-to-use online tools. When cross referencing, note that some brands offer premium lines with better filtration. For instance, a standard filter might have a 95% efficiency rating, while a premium one reaches 99%. Always prioritize filters that meet or exceed OEM specifications to protect your engine.

Potential Pitfalls and How to Avoid Them

While cross referencing is beneficial, there are risks if done incorrectly. One common mistake is assuming all filters with the same thread size are compatible. Thread size is just one factor; differences in gasket placement or height can cause leaks. For instance, a filter that is slightly taller might not fit in the allocated space. Another pitfall is ignoring the bypass valve pressure. If this valve opens at the wrong pressure, it could allow unfiltered oil to circulate, leading to engine wear. Also, beware of counterfeit filters sold online that look identical but use inferior materials. To avoid these issues, always purchase from reputable sellers and check for certification marks. Physically compare the old and new filters before installation. Look for any differences in port sizes or valve types. If in doubt, consult a professional or stick with the OEM recommendation. Additionally, some vehicles, especially newer models with advanced engines, may have specific requirements that limit cross reference options. Always prioritize safety over savings.

Advanced Tips for Professional-Grade Cross Referencing

For those who want to take cross referencing to the next level, consider advanced techniques that professionals use. Start by understanding filter specifications in depth. Look beyond basic size and check the micron rating, which indicates the size of particles the filter can trap. A lower micron number means better filtration. Also, consider the capacity of the filter media; a larger capacity can extend oil change intervals. Another tip is to use cross reference for performance upgrades. For example, if you drive a high-mileage vehicle, you might cross reference to a filter with anti-drain back valves to reduce dry starts. Additionally, keep a personal database of successful cross references for your vehicles. This saves time in the future. When dealing with rare or vintage cars, consult specialty forums or clubs, as standard tools might not have data. Finally, stay updated with industry changes; filter models are periodically updated, so re-check cross references periodically. This proactive approach ensures long-term engine health.
